Posted by: James Adams Aug 2 2003, 08:37 AM

We're home! mueba.gif

The car did great - it really was not that hot in the car even though a gas station attendant in Arizona said it was 104 outside!

We stayed in Flagstaff the first night, and it was going so well that I decided to just keep going yesterday. Got in at 2:00 this morning.

I have pics that I will post soon.

The only issue I had was some vapor lock yesterday afternoon. The fuel pump is still in the rear location, and I think we picked up some gas that was more sensitive to that (since it was actually hotter the first day and we had not problems).

After a stop we had a hard time getting it going, and it quit twice on the highway from it.

The solution was to pour some water (is my 914 water-cooled now? rolleyes.gif ) on the pump and cycle it to get the air out. It was kind of cool to hear the air bubbles coming up in the gas tank. blink.gif

Once the sun went down it was fine. Not bad for a 30 year old car under pretty extreme conditions.
